Help for a NY Nestie?

Hi ladies! My DH and I are planning to move to the Cleveland area to join the rest of our family who have been settling out that way. I know nothing about the area and my family who lives there does not have school age children, so they really can't give advice on good school districts, family friendly towns, etc. Our family is in Shaker Heights and Chagrin Falls so those are really the only 2 places I've been, other than the actual city of Cleveland.

If you wouldn't mind I would really appreciate some help with my questions, since there isn't a better resource than people who actually live in the area!

-What towns would you recommend for newlyweds looking to start a family?
-What towns have the highest taxes?
-What towns have the best schools?
-My DH is a teacher, so I have to also ask... what are the best districts to teach in?

Any help and/or advice would be fantastic. I have never lived anywhere except for NY and NJ so it is a bit intimidating to decide to pick up and move to an entirely different area, which I know nothing about. Thank you so much!

we just moved back from atlanta to cle and we are looking at beachwood, pepperpike, solon and orange- they are on the east side and have really good public schools.  

 

taxes are very high in all but solon, but the area/location is great. HTH
